Each Owner acknowledges that: (i) the construction of <br />the Development and any future Phases on the Property may occur over an extended period of time; (ii) <br />the quiet use and enjoyment of the Owner’s Unit may be disturbed as a result of the noise, odors, dust, <br />vibrations, and other effects of construction activities; and (iii) the disturbance may continue until the <br />completion of the construction of the Development and any future Phases on the Property. <br /> <br />Section 2.8 Annexation of Additional Property. Additional property may, but is not <br />required to, be annexed to and become subject to this Declaration in one or more subsequent phases in <br />accordance with the provisions set forth in this section. <br /> <br />(a) Annexation Pursuant to Plan. The Annexation Property may be annexed to <br />and become a part of the Development in Phases, subject to this Declaration, and subject to the <br />jurisdiction of the Association, without the assent of the Association or its Members, and without the <br />assent of the Condominium Owners, on condition that: <br /> <br />(1) Plan Approved. Any annexation and development of additional Phases <br />shall be in substantial conformance with a plan of phased development approved by the BRE. The <br />issuance of a Public Report for a Phase by the BRE shall be evidence that the annexation of that Phase <br />was in substantial conformance with a plan of phased development. <br /> <br />(2) Declaration of Annexation. A Declaration of Annexation shall be <br />recorded covering the applicable portion of the property to be annexed. The Declaration of Annexation <br />may, without limitation (i) contain such complementary additions and modifications of the covenants and <br />restrictions contained in this Declaration as are appropriate to include the property to be annexed in the <br />Development, and as may be necessary to reflect the different character, if any, of the added property, and <br />as are not inconsistent with the scheme of this Declaration, (ii) provide a date for commencement of <br />Assessments in the applicable Phase, and (iii) describe additional property, facilities or other <br />improvements to be maintained by the Association.
